Description

Shows you all possible modifiers you can roll/craft on vault gear at any level.

In-game version of the gear page, you don't have to leave the game now to see what you can modifiers you can get .

Triangles with the same color indicate modifier exclusivity (you can't roll 2 modifiers with the same color).

You can open the screen by pressing the "Gear Modifiers" button in the Vault Screen (right below the quest button) or by pressing dedicated keybind (unbound by default).

You can disable or move the button in the config.

Client side only

Integration with existing features:

Unique codex tooltip is replaced with VHat Can I Roll? engine

Artisan station info can be replaced by VHCIR info (toggleable)

  • this fixes modifiers like clouds and extra levels, adds chances, wraps the modifier description to fit the window
  • artisan station info width is configurable

Keyboard navigation:

KEY   ACTION
left arrow (h)   decrease lvl
right arrow (l)   increase lvl
up arrow (k)   scroll up
down arrow (j)   scroll down
tab   move to next gear piece
shift + tab   move to previous gear piece
ctrl   increase tier Normal -> Greater -> Legendary
shift + ctrl   decrease tier
